How would you guys clean up minor surface rust on a cage before paint? Scotchbrite? Steel wool and WD40?

I just used 400 grit 3M Wet-or-Dry sandpaper without oil. If you use WD-40 and get it into the weld joints you'll play hell getting it all cleaned out of there. WD-40 is good for causing "fisheyes" in paint. We used to shoot to kill, anybody that even possessed a can of WD-40 in our paint/body shop when I did paintwork for the local Dodge dealership.

NO WD-40........400grit paper will work, black biscuit disc for the welds if the paper doesnt get all surface rust out of the welds

Use some body shop Metal Prep and a scotch brite pad after the 400 dry and before you prime. Be sure to use gloves as this is a weak acid solution.
